7. Stockholders’ Equity

Common Shares Outstanding

Common shares outstanding excludes treasury shares totaling 6.3 million at both March 31, 2024 and December 31, 2023, with a first-in-first-out cost basis of $227.8 million and $236.7 million at March 31, 2024 and December 31, 2023, respectively. Shares outstanding also excludes unvested restricted share awards totaling $0.3 million at both March 31, 2024 and December 31, 2023.

Stock Buyback Program

On January 26, 2023, the Company’s board of directors approved a stock buyback program whereby the Company is authorized to repurchase up to approximately 4.3 million shares of its outstanding common stock through the program’s expiration date of December 31, 2024. The program allows the Company to repurchase its common shares in the open market, by block purchase, through accelerated share repurchase programs, in privately negotiated transactions, or otherwise, in one or more transactions from time to time, depending on market conditions and other factors, and in accordance with applicable regulations of the Securities and Exchange Commission. The Company is not obligated to purchase any shares under this program, and the board of directors has the ability to terminate or amend the program at any time prior to the expiration date. At March 31, 2024, Company had not repurchased shares under this program.

Accumulated Other Comprehensive Income or Loss (“AOCI”) is reported as a component of stockholders’ equity. AOCI can include, among other items, unrealized holding gains and losses on securities available for sale (“AFS”), including the Company’s share of unrealized gains and losses reported by a partnership accounted for under the equity method, gains and losses associated with pension or other post-retirement benefits that are not recognized immediately as a component of net periodic benefit cost, and gains and losses on derivative instruments that are designated as, and qualify as, cash flow hedges. Net unrealized gains and losses on AFS securities reclassified as securities held to maturity (“HTM”) also continue to be reported as a component of AOCI and will be amortized over the estimated remaining life of the securities as an adjustment to interest income. Subject to certain thresholds, unrealized losses on employee benefit plans will be reclassified into income as pension and post-retirement costs are recognized over the remaining service period of plan participants. Accumulated gains or losses on cash flow hedges of variable rate loans described in Note 6 - Derivatives will be reclassified into income over the life of the hedge. Accumulated other comprehensive loss resulting from the terminated interest rate swaps are being amortized over the remaining maturities of the designated instruments. Gains and losses within AOCI are net of deferred income taxes, where applicable.
